hu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]VPS搭建私有CDN,提升访问速度与数据安全|搭建vps自用,VPS搭建私有CDN

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

通过在VPS上搭建私有CDN,可以有效提升网站内容的访问速度和数据的安全性。VPS,即虚拟专用服务器,它能提供与专用服务器相似的性能和可靠性,但成本相对较低。搭建私有CDN,可以将网站的内容分发到更靠近用户的服务器上,减少数据传输的距离和时间,从而加快访问速度。由于数据只在私有网络中传输,可以有效提升数据的安全性,防止数据在传输过程中被窃取篡改。搭建VPS自用,不仅可以节省成本,还可以提供更灵活的管理和配置选项,满足个性化的需求。

本文目录导读:

  1. 选择合适的VPS提供商
  2. 搭建CDN服务器
  3. 测试和优化

随着互联网的快速发展,网站的访问速度和数据安全成为越来越受到重视的问题,为了提高用户体验和保护数据安全,许多网站开始采用CDN(内容分发网络)技术,CDN可以将网站的内容分发到全球各地的节点,用户可以从距离最近的节点访问内容,从而提高访问速度,商用CDN服务往往需要支付定的费用,而且可能存在数据安全方面的风险,在这种情况下,使用VPS搭建私有CDN成为了一种不错的选择。

VPS(Virtual Private Server)是一种虚拟专用服务器,具有独立的计算、存储和网络资源,通过在VPS上搭建CDN,我们可以实现自定义化的内容分发,提高访问速度,并保障数据安全,下面将详细介绍如何使用VPS搭建私有CDN。

选择合适的VPS提供商

需要选择一家可靠的VPS提供商,在选择VPS提供商时,要考虑以下几个因素:

1、服务器位置:选择离目标用户较近的服务器位置,可以有效提高访问速度。

2、服务器配置:确保VPS具有足够的计算、存储和网络资源,以满足CDN搭建和运行的需求。

3、网络质量:提供商的网络质量直接影响到CDN的效果,要选择网络稳定性好、带宽充足的提供商。

4、技术支持:选择提供良好技术支持的提供商,以便在搭建和运行过程中遇到问题时能得到及时解决。

搭建CDN服务器

1、安装操作系统:首先在VPS上安装合适的操作系统,如CentOS、Ubuntu等。

2、更新系统软件:确保系统软件更新到最新版本,以提高安全性和稳定性。

3、安装CDN软件:选择一款适合的CDN软件,如OpenResty、Nginx等,在这里以Nginx为例,介绍如何安装和配置CDN服务器。

a. 安装Nginx:使用yum命令安装Nginx。

```

sudo yum install nginx

```

b. 配置Nginx:修改Nginx配置文件,设置CDN服务器的相关参数。

```

server {

listen 80;

server_name your_domain.com;

location / {

root /path/to/your/content;

proxy_set_header Host $host;

proxy_set_header X-Real-IP $remote_addr;

pro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;

proxy_pass http://backend_server_ip;

}

}

```

c. 重启Nginx服务。

```

sudo systemctl restart nginx

```

4、配置后端服务器:在另一台服务器上搭建应用程序,并将其实例化多个副本,作为CDN的后台服务器,可以使用相同的Nginx配置,通过修改proxy_pass参数指向不同的后端服务器。

测试和优化

1、测试CDN效果:使用工具(如CDN测试器)测试VPS搭建的私有CDN的性能和覆盖范围,确保其满足需求。

2、优化CDN配置:根据测试结果,调整CDN服务器和后端服务器的配置,以提高访问速度和数据安全。

通过以上步骤,我们在VPS上成功搭建了私有CDN,使用私有CDN,我们可以自定义化的内容分发,提高访问速度,并保障数据安全,私有CDN的搭建和维护成本相对较低,非常适合中小型网站和个人开发者。

以下是一些与本文相关的关键词:

VPS, 私有CDN, 访问速度, 数据安全, 内容分发网络, 网站性能, 服务器配置, 网络质量, 技术支持, OpenResty, Nginx, CentOS, Ubuntu, CDN测试器, 后台服务器, 实例化, 应用程序, 性能优化.

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

VPS搭建私有CDN:vps搭建个人云盘

原文链接:,转发请注明来源!